导言
“TP钱包转圈”常指钱包客户端在发起交易、签名或同步时长时间停滞在加载状态。表面看是界面卡顿,深层涉及网络、链端、签名流程、前端逻辑与基础设施稳定性。本文从用户与开发者角度系统剖析成因,结合新兴与前沿技术讨论改进路径,并考察全球化智能支付与可审计性要求下的设计要点。
一、常见成因(用户与系统层面)
- 网络与RPC:不稳定的网络或提供商RPC限流、节点延迟导致请求长时间未返回。部分公共RPC存在QPS限制或断连。
- 签名与密钥管理:本地签名失败、硬件签名器响应慢、MPC/TEE交互超时等会卡住签名流程。
- 交易池与费率:链上拥堵、gas估算失败或nonce冲突(pending交易阻塞)会导致交易无法被矿工采纳,前端反复重试显示“转圈”。
- 前端与状态管理:异步处理、未处理异常、无限重试或无超时退避的实现错误。
- 数据同步与缓存:余额、nonce、合约ABI或chainId不同步引起请求失败。
二、数字签名与安全机制
- 常见算法:ECDSA(secp256k1)、Ed25519在签名速度与实现复杂度上的差异;后者对某些链更友好。
- 聚合与门限签名:BLS聚合签名、阈值签名(MPC)在多签场景下减少交互次数和延迟,但需处理网络同步与协作失败的回退机制。
- EIP-712与可验证签名:结构化签名可以减少误签风险并提升可审计性,尤其在社交恢复与账号抽象场景下重要。
三、前沿技术应用(缓解转圈与提升体验)
- 账号抽象(Account Abstraction/ ERC-4337):通过入口合约和Bundler,支持更灵活的重试、支付代币gas和社会恢复,减少因本地签名策略导致的卡顿。
- 链下聚合与L2:使用zk-rollups或 optimistic rollups把交易打包上链,减少主链延迟与拥堵,前端可在L2层更快获得确认反馈。
- 零知识技术:zk-SNARK/zk-STARK可用于隐私保护同时提供可验证的证明链路,便于在不暴露详细数据的情况下实现审计。
- 安全执行环境:TEE(如Intel SGX)与受信任的执行层用于保护私钥交互,但需要设计掉线或超时保护以避免“转圈”时长。
- 智能路由与多RPC策略:客户端动态测量RPC健康,自动切换与回退,使用本地缓存与指数退避策略避免无效重试。
四、全球化智能支付与互操作性

- 多货币与合规:支持法币通道、稳定币与CBDC互操作,需对接多种支付rails并处理合规(KYC/AML)与跨境清算延迟。
- ISO20022与消息标准:采用标准化消息格式有助于银行与链上互通,降低误差与重试。
- 跨链桥与中继:桥的安全性与可用性直接影响交易最终性,设计上应提供可回滚或补偿机制以避免前端长时间等待。
- 全球节点部署与CDN:在全球化场景下,通过边缘节点与近端RPC提升响应速度,降低区域性网络问题导致的“转圈”。
五、可审计性与运维可观测性
- 可验证日志与证明:为关键操作(签名、nonce变更、交易广播)生成不可篡改的日志或Merkle证明,方便事后审计。

- 分布式监控与告警:收集SDK、RPC、后台打包器与节点的指标(延时、错误率、重试次数),并触发自动回退策略。
- 交易可追踪性:结合链上事件与链下日志,建立端到端追溯链路,便于监管与合规审计。
- 隐私与审计平衡:采用选择性披露或零知识证明在保护用户隐私同时满足审计需求。
六、实用修复建议(用户与开发者)
- 用户层面:检查网络、切换移动数据/Wi‑Fi,重启App或切换节点,查看区块浏览器pending记录,若为nonce或费用问题尝试加gas重发或取消交易。切勿向客服暴露私钥或助记词。
- 开发者层面:实现超时、退避与多RPC切换;在签名流程中加入可取消操作、进度提示与合理超时;对MPC/TEE路径提供本地回退方案;提供一键重试/替换交易(replace-by-fee)功能。
七、未来展望
- AI辅助诊断:客户端内置诊断助手实时分析转圈原因并给出修复建议。
- 去中心化中继网络:基于信誉的中继服务自动选择最快最可靠的路径,减少集中RPC的单点瓶颈。
- 可证明的可用性指标:为每个节点/服务公开可验证SLA指标(延迟、成功率),提升整体透明度与可审计性。
结论
“TP钱包转圈”既是产品体验问题,也是底层多系统协同问题的集中体现。通过采用账号抽象、门限签名、零知识证明、全局节点部署与完善的可观测性体系,可以显著降低卡顿概率,同时在全球化智能支付场景下保持合规与可审计性。对用户而言,遵循安全操作与基本排错步骤;对开发者与运维团队,则需把弹性、降级策略与可证明日志作为系统设计的核心。
评论
AlexChen
写得很全面,我按建议切换了RPC后问题改善了。
小樱
对数字签名和阈签的解释很清楚,尤其是可审计性部分让我受益匪浅。
LunaWallet
希望未来能看到去中心化中继的实践案例,文章的路线图很有启发。
张三
实用性强,特别是用户与开发者的分层建议,已经转给团队讨论。
CryptoGuru
把零知识与可审计性结合讲得很好,平衡隐私和合规是关键。